Product Specifications
Dimensions: 10.2" tall, 5" wide, and 8.4" deep Fits on most bookshelves. (assembled).
Materials: Crafted from high-quality MDF board with vibrant UV prints.
Assembly: 330 pieces, 6-8 hours of build time. All tools included.
Power: USB-C. Wall adapter and cord not included.
Age range: 14 and older.

What comes included with your kits?
We include everything you need to build. You will receive craft glue, a mini screwdriver, and craft tweezers.
We have designed the book nook so that parts fit together well, but we have also included a nail file in the case that sanding a part is required (which should be rare).
How are the lights powered?
We've created a vivid electrical system that anyone can put together, powered by USB-C.
All the connections are either pre-made, or can be clicked into our circuit board. The wall adapter and extension cord are not included.
